Why Does He Say Hurtful Things to Me?
Relationships can be complicated and emotionally challenging, especially when hurtful words are involved. It can be confusing and painful to understand why someone you care about would say hurtful things to you. In this article, we will explore some common reasons behind this behavior and provide insights into this complex issue.
1. Is it intentional?
Sometimes, hurtful words are intentionally used as a means to control, manipulate, or hurt the other person. It can be a way for someone to express their anger, frustration, or dissatisfaction with the relationship. However, it is important to note that not all hurtful words are intentional. Sometimes, individuals may say things in the heat of the moment without fully realizing the impact of their words.
2. Can it be a defense mechanism?
In some cases, people may resort to hurtful words as a defense mechanism. They may feel vulnerable, threatened, or insecure, and using hurtful language becomes a way for them to protect themselves. This defensive behavior can stem from past experiences or unresolved issues that have shaped their communication style.
3. Is it a reflection of their own insecurities?
Sometimes, hurtful words are a reflection of the person’s own insecurities and self-esteem issues. By putting others down, they may temporarily feel a sense of superiority or control. However, this behavior is often a sign of deeper emotional struggles that need to be addressed.
4. Could it be a lack of emotional intelligence?
Some individuals may struggle with emotional intelligence, making it difficult for them to express their feelings in a healthy and constructive way. They may lash out with hurtful words simply because they lack the skills to communicate effectively and manage their emotions.
5. Can it be a result of unresolved conflicts?
Unresolved conflicts or unresolved issues within the relationship can contribute to hurtful language. If past disagreements or hurts have not been properly addressed or resolved, they can resurface during future conflicts, leading to the use of hurtful words.
6. Does it indicate a lack of respect?
Using hurtful words can be a sign of disrespect in a relationship. It shows a disregard for the other person’s feelings and can erode the trust and intimacy between partners. It is important to establish clear boundaries and communicate openly about what is acceptable and what is not in terms of communication.
7. How can it be addressed?
Addressing hurtful language in a relationship is crucial for its health and well-being. It requires open and honest communication between partners, where both parties can express their feelings, concerns, and needs. Couples therapy or relationship counseling can also provide a safe space to explore the underlying issues and develop healthier communication strategies.
